The COPD Score in 27239, Denton, North Carolina is 13 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

79.93 percent of the population in 27239 drive to work alone. 0.21 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 50.12 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 7.14 percent of the residents in 27239 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.03 members with about 2.32 cars available per household.

An estimate of 87.56 percent of the residents in 27239 has some form of health insurance. 35.22 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 65.17 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 27239 would have to travel an average of 17.30 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Randolph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 27239, Denton, North Carolina.

As of , an estimate of 8,041 residents live in 27239 with a median age of 51.5 years. 17.27 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 21.53 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 35.99 percent of the residents in 27239 is currently married, and 19.31 percent of the population has never been married.

The monthly median household income in 27239 is $5,537.42.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 27239 is approximately $691. The median household spends about 12.48 percent of their income on housing.

COPD, or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ease, is a chronic inflammatory lung disease that causes obstructed airflow from the lungs. It can lead to breathing difficulties, coughing, and other respiratory symptoms. For individuals living with COPD, access to quality healthcare is vital for managing their condition and improving their quality of life.
